Chemka Hot Springs Day Tour – A Hidden Oasis Beneath Kilimanjaro

Overview

Somewhere between the dusty roads of Boma Ng’ombe and the wide shadow of Mount Kilimanjaro, a secret waits for you. Surrounded by fig trees and tucked deep in the savannah, Chemka Hot Springs isn’t famous, and that’s its power because you won’t find it crowded.

Crystal-clear water bubbles up from underground caves, warm and impossibly blue. Monkeys chatter overhead, tree roots dangle into the pools, and for a few quiet hours—nothing exists but sunlight, laughter, and stillness.

Itinerary Summary

08:00 – Pickup from Arusha

We collect you right from your hotel in Arusha after breakfast. It’s a slow, scenic drive through little villages, sisal plantations, and maize fields. Kids wave from dusty doorways, and Mt. Kilimanjaro plays peekaboo behind the haze. By the time we reach Chemka, the only sound left is birds and breeze.

10:00 – Arrival at Chemka Hot Springs

You step out and immediately feel it: calm. Water so clear it mirrors the sky. Fig trees wrapping like old arms around the pools. And that smell—clean, leafy, honest.

Your guide sets up a shaded rest spot with chairs and refreshments. Then you wade in.

10:30 – 13:30 | Swim, Float, Breathe

This is yours to enjoy however you want. Float on your back beneath sunlight-dappled leaves. Let the warm water wrap around your legs. Swing from the rope like a kid again and plunge in laughing. Or just sit at the edge, toes in the water, and watch dragonflies skim the surface.

You can chat with fellow travelers, read a book in a hammock, or fall asleep to birdsong. There’s no agenda—just peace.

13:30 – Picnic Lunch by the Water

We bring a fresh packed lunch—grilled chicken or veggie wraps, fresh fruit, and cold drinks. You’ll eat with your feet in the grass and the sound of water trickling nearby.
